地铁车辆基地司机登车平台优化设计 被引量:1

Optimization design of driver boarding platform in metro vehicle base

摘要 文章通过对地铁车辆基地司机登车平台布置型式及特征研究分析,提出以下观点:①司机登车平台台阶应朝向通道位置;②司机登车平台应安装在司机室司机视角的左侧车门位置;③全自动驾驶地铁,司机登车平台应采取对地绝缘措施;④为更好的适应停车位置的变化和地面施工误差,司机登车平台台面高度应能连续微调。 Based on the study and analysis of the layout and characteristics of the driver's boarding platform in metro vehicle base,this paper puts forward the following views:①the steps of the driver's boarding platform should face the passage position;②the driver's boarding platform should be installed in the left door position of the driver's view in the cab;③the driver's boarding platform should take insulation measures to the ground for fully automatic operation FAO metro;④in order to better adapt to parking,the height of the platform should be fine aligned continuously for the change of position and the error of ground construction.
